Supplying electrical wholesalers across the UK
Navitas Circuit Protection is a Welsh electrical equipment company specializing in circuit protection products. The business employs twelve people, supplies electrical wholesalers across the UK, and is on course to achieve annual revenues of around £2.5 million. In 2025, Navitas was recognized with the Best New Start-Up award at the South Wales Business Awards.
Rapid growth brings opportunity, but it also creates operational challenges. From the very beginning, Founder and Managing Director William Winter knew the business needed strong systems behind it if it was going to scale successfully.
Building the foundations properly
Navitas was founded in 2023 by William and his father, Bill Winter, following William’s departure from the electrical manufacturing industry after more than a decade of experience.
Starting a manufacturing business from scratch meant every decision mattered. With only two people in the business, there was no room for inefficient processes or duplicated administration.
“We made a conscious decision that we wanted to build the business on proper systems from day one,” says William. “It’s much easier to implement good processes with two people than it is with twenty.”
While Bill focused on selecting an accounting package, William began searching for an MRP system capable of handling purchasing, inventory, bills of materials, and production planning without requiring a significant upfront investment.
“I’d previously worked with enterprise-level software that cost tens of thousands of pounds to implement. That simply wasn’t realistic for a startup.”
The search eventually landed with William’s long-time friend, Junii Whyte, who is now also a Director at Navitas.
“Junii enjoys researching software far more than I do,” William laughs. “I gave him our requirements and asked him to investigate the options. After testing several systems, he came back and recommended MRPeasy.”
Up and running in weeks
Once Navitas became a full-time business, implementation began immediately.
Within weeks, the team had imported customer records, suppliers, stock items, and bills of materials, allowing operations to begin on a structured platform rather than relying on spreadsheets.
“The import tools made the process surprisingly straightforward,” says William. “There was a lot of information to load into the system, but once it was there, we were able to start operating almost immediately.”
As the company evolved, so did the software.
New product ranges, pricing structures, additional users, and changing business processes were all incorporated without requiring the company to replace the system.
“The way we operate today is very different from when we started, but MRPeasy has adapted with us.”

Turning information into better decisions
One area where William believes MRPeasy delivers particular value is access to data.
With thousands of products, components, and customer records in the system, quickly finding the right information has become increasingly important.
“The search functionality is excellent. Whether you’re searching for a customer, a purchase order, a product code or almost anything else, it’s incredibly quick. When several part numbers differ by only a single character, that saves a huge amount of time.”
The reporting tools have also helped remove emotion from operational decisions.
“Like most manufacturers, we occasionally receive product returns. At one point, it felt as though faulty returns were increasing.”
Instead of relying on assumptions, the team analyzed the data.
“We looked back over twelve months and found we’d sold around 178,000 units while only receiving 38 products back that were confirmed as faulty. The data immediately put the situation into perspective and stopped us from making decisions based on perception rather than evidence.”
Mobility that suits a growing business
Because MRPeasy is cloud-based, the Navitas team can work wherever they happen to be.
Sales representatives update customer information while visiting wholesalers, management can monitor operations remotely, and staff always have access to current information.
“I can manage the business from almost anywhere,” says William. “Our sales team can update customer information while they’re sitting with customers instead of waiting until they’re back in the office.”
Another feature William highlights is the customer portal. Many Navitas customers place repeat orders throughout the year. Rather than emailing purchase orders or manually processing repeat transactions, customers can log in, access their agreed pricing, view invoices, check delivery information, and place orders themselves.
“It reduces administration for both our customers and us while also minimizing the risk of manual input errors.”
